摘要
The interaction of the two tetraazamacrocyclic transition-metal complexes. ML(ClO(4))(2)(M=Cu(2+), Ni(2+), L = 5,12-dimethyl-7,14-diphenyl-1.4,8,11-tetraazamacrocycl-4,11-diene) with calf thymus-DNA (CT-DNA) were studied by cyclic voltammetry. In the presence of CT-DNA, the oxidion peaks of [CuL](2+) and [NiL](2+) shifted to more positive values and the peak current increased significantly. The experimental results indicate that the two complexes could interact with CT-DNA mainly by intercalation binding mode
